About this property

Fernwood Lodge, Belton, Norfolk

Summary:

Fernwood Lodge in Fritton near Belton, sleeps four guests in two bedrooms.



The Space:

Fernwood Lodge, a single-storey caravan, consists of a kitchen/diner with gas oven and hob, microwave, fridge/freezer, and dining seating for six people, and a sitting room with smart TV and corner sofa. The bedrooms consist of a double and twin. There is a shower room with walk-in shower, basin, and WC. WiFi, fuel, power, bed linen, and towels are included in the rent. Outside, there is an enclosed decking area with furniture and off-road parking for one car. One well-behaved pet is welcome. Sorry, no smoking. Whatever the weather, a wonderful stay awaits at Fernwood Lodge. Note: Steps up to the property, please take care.
